Subject: [PATCH] powercap/intel_rapl: Add support for Kabylake
Date: Fri, 22 Apr 2016 10:17:19 -0700	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1461345439-21215-1-git-send-email-jacob.jun.pan@linux.intel.com> (raw)

Kabylake is similar to Skylake in terms of RAPL.

Signed-off-by: Jacob Pan <jacob.jun.pan@linux.intel.com>
---
 drivers/powercap/intel_rapl.c | 2 ++
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+)

diff --git a/drivers/powercap/intel_rapl.c b/drivers/powercap/intel_rapl.c
index 8fad0a7..470bb62 100644
--- a/drivers/powercap/intel_rapl.c
+++ b/drivers/powercap/intel_rapl.c
@@ -1101,6 +1101,8 @@ static const struct x86_cpu_id rapl_ids[] __initconst = {
 	RAPL_CPU(0X5C, rapl_defaults_core),/* Broxton */
 	RAPL_CPU(0x5E, rapl_defaults_core),/* Skylake-H/S */
 	RAPL_CPU(0x57, rapl_defaults_hsw_server),/* Knights Landing */
+	RAPL_CPU(0x8E, rapl_defaults_core),/* Kabylake */
+	RAPL_CPU(0x9E, rapl_defaults_core),/* Kabylake */
 	{}
 };
 MODULE_DEVICE_TABLE(x86cpu, rapl_ids);
